What is the best and easiest photo editor program that you all use?

Looking to make a collage with my monthly update pics to see the progression in one pic.

Any suggestions?? Thanks!

eman,

if i understood correctly what you are trying to achieve, then forget photoshop.
i recommend *GIF Construction Set Professional* by Alchemy Mindworks hands down.

i've been using it for many years now for some p/t web developing work.
its got amazing wizard that will do everything for you with a click of a button.
you just simply load some gifs or jpgs in a specific order, click the button, and watch the magic happen in just few seconds and it comes out as only one picture Cool
